Tajik and Russian officials have discussed the situation of Tajik labor migrants during the pandemic. 

On November 30, Tajik Ambassador to Russia Imomuddin Sattorov met in Moscow with Russian Minister of Construction and Housing Irek Faizullin.

The two reportedly discussed issues related to recruiting skilled Tajik specialist for work in the Russian construction sector. 

Tajik diplomat noted that the authorities in Tajikistan are interested in using investment opportunities of the Russian business in construction and industrial sectors of the country, according to the Tajik diplomatic mission in Moscow.  

Meanwhile Tajik Ministry of Labor, Migration and Employment of the Population of Tajikistan, Ms. Shirin Amonzoda, on December 1 met ere with Russian Ambassador to Tajikistan Igor Lyakin-Frolov.

According to the Tajik Labor Ministry press center, they discussed  development of the common statistical system, living conditions of labor migrants in Russia, organized recruitment and sending of labor migrants to the Russian Federation by charter flights.

Amonzoda and Lyakin-Frolov reportedly also discussed the establishment of joint labor training centers in Tajikistan and development of the joint labor migration program.
